A good, clean copy of The Antique Collector ~ Vol. 43 ~ No. 5, published in October 1972. Contents include learned articles on, "A Journal for the Glass Circle" ~ "Stapleford Park, Leicestershire : The Home of the Lord and Lady Gretton" ~ "Augsburg Hausmaler Decoration on Meissen Porcelain", by Walter de Sager ~ "Some Desirable Pieces of Early Oak", by C.K. Binns ~ "Collecting Chinese Cloisonne Enamel", by Michael Gillingham ~ "The Surrey Antiques Fair" ~ "The Rudding Park Sale" ~ "Chinese Ceramics : The Postan Collection" ~ "Victorian Artists of "Punch"", by Ronald Pearsall, and "Porcelain Spoontrays : A Postscript", by Geoffrey A. Godden, plus regular features. Soft covers.
